You have to be very careful about using your allowance to fund the chair, My experience is that the repayment schemes are very expensive and the one-off cost of a new chair could well be a lot less than the interest you will be paying on what is in effect a high-interest loan repayment scheme

@Durhamjaide Will the wheelchair need lifting in and out of a boot of a car is that why you need a light weight chair.lightweight electric wheelchairs are not always sturdy for outdoor uneven terrain use so please be careful when you choose.Repairs can cost a fortune as spares come at extortionate prices.Have you considered NHS electric wheelchair which can take months but are free + free repairs maintenance + replacement?
referral is via GP/physio/OT/ nurse.If you need indoors and outdoors then you should meet NHS criteria.Invacare Ltd
sunrise medical
ottobock Ltd
do sturdy wheelchairs.Please ask dealer to try at home before you buy.Hope this was of some help.Sorry can’t help you about grants. -
